Battery Life and Charging
Battery longevity is a critical aspect of long-term reliability. The HP Envy X360 14 2026 generally maintains good battery health for the first 1-2 years. Over time, users report a gradual decrease in maximum capacity, typical of lithium-ion batteries. Regular calibration and careful charging habits help extend battery life, but eventual replacement may be necessary after several years of use.

Maintenance and Care Tips
To ensure long-term reliability, users should regularly clean the device, avoid exposing it to extreme temperatures, and use a cooling pad during demanding tasks. Keeping software up to date and performing routine disk cleanups can also prevent performance degradation. Proper handling and storage extend the lifespan of internal components and peripherals.
